Arsenal take on Bournemouth at the Emirates Stadium on Saturday. The Gunners can put 12 points between themselves and Manchester City by the time City play Chelsea at Stamford Bridge.

00:00It's a big weekend of football ahead of us for London teams.
00:04Roberto De Zerbe takes on his first match as Tottenham manager away at Sunderland on Sunday.
00:11Chelsea will be hoping to back up their 7-0 FA Cup victory over Port Vale.
00:17The Blues play Manchester City at home in what could prove to be a crucial game in the title race,
00:23especially for Arsenal, who kick off early on Saturday against Bournemouth at the Emirates Stadium.
00:30Arsenal will be coming off the back of a victory in Lisbon after Kai Havertz came off the bench to
00:36grab a last-minute winner.
00:38David Raya got man of the match in that game.
00:41Here's what Mikel Arteta said after the match about the team's performance and the goalkeeper.
